Weird clicking/whirring noises on startup

Hey guys...first post...be gentle.

I bought a used 2006 G35 Sedan, Manual Transmission back in May. No problems until now...absolutely love this car! Right now about 78k miles on the clock.

So when I started it this morning and I backed out the garage, when I was idling I hear this strange clicking/whirring noise. The only thing I can compare it to would be like on the price is right, when they spin that huge wheel, and the clicks you hear as the wheel spins and the arrow points at the dollar amounts. I know...first thing that came to my mind.

It makes the same noise as I'm changing gears from 1st, 2nd, 3rd, etc. I accelerate, depress the clutch (noise occurs), change gears, accelerate, and the noise disappears.

Even with the noise there is nothing else to indicate anything is wrong. Shifting smoothly, everything else works great.

Now all noises completely stop as soon as the car is warmed up.

I've done a lot of searching and have seen all kinds of solutions like throw out bearing, fluids, clutch, etc. Was hoping someone could help me out!
